Plaza Premium Lounge opens new facilities in Taipei

27 Jul 2016 by Clement Huang

Plaza Premium Lounge has opened two new pay-in lounge facilities in Taipei’s Taoyuan International Airport, accessible to all travellers regardless of travel class or airline.

Located in the Departures zone of Terminal 1 and Terminal 2, the two lounges span a total of 2,500 sqm in size and can accommodate up to 600 guests.

“Trees and timber” is the design theme for the new facilities, with neutral shades, panelled walls and artistic details such as a carving of Taiwan island, as well as a three-metre bas-relief sculpture depicting Taipei 101 and the Xinyi district skyline in the Terminal 2 facility.

Both lounges feature the brand’s signature honeycomb seating, shower facilities, private resting rooms, VIP suites, and plenty of electrical outlets. Complimentary wifi is available throughout each facility.

There is also a dedicated buffet area and live-cooking station serving freshly-made international dishes.

The basic package for entry into the Plaza Premium Lounge in either Terminal 1 or Terminal 2 starts at NT$1,300 (US$40) for two hours.
